Hidden Costs in Voice Agent Pricing You Won't See on the Rate Card

Every voice agent vendor leads with a headline number. A few cents per minute, maybe less at volume. It looks cheap, it fits neatly in a spreadsheet, and it makes the buying decision feel easy. Then the first real invoice arrives, and the finance team asks why the bill is three or four times the model they built. The gap is not fraud. It is structure. The advertised rate covers a narrow slice of what actually happens on a call, and the rest arrives as separate line items — or worse, as costs that never appear on any invoice at all.
This post maps the gap between the advertised rate and the true all-in cost. It is not a general per-minute explainer, and it is not about cost per resolution as a metric. It is about the surprises — the fees, the engineering, and the quality failures that quietly inflate the real bill.
Why the advertised rate is only a fraction
A per-minute rate is a unit cost, and unit costs are seductive because they scale linearly in your head. Ten thousand minutes at five cents feels like five hundred dollars. Clean, predictable, done.
The trouble is that a voice agent is not one product. It is a stack of metered services stitched together, plus the human and engineering effort to keep it running. The advertised rate usually reflects the vendor's orchestration layer and little else. Everything underneath it — and everything around it — is priced separately or absorbed by your own team. Proper total cost of ownership accounting counts all of it, not just the sticker.
The result is a familiar pattern. The rate you compare across vendors is the one number that varies least. The costs that actually determine your bill are the ones nobody puts on the slide.
The pass-through component fees
Under the hood, a voice agent runs a pipeline. Speech-to-text turns the caller's audio into words. A language model decides what to say. Text-to-speech turns the reply back into audio. Telephony carries the call. Each of these is a metered service, and each is often billed separately from the orchestration rate.
Here is where buyers get surprised. Some vendors quote a rate that bundles these components; others quote a thin orchestration fee and pass the component costs straight through to you. Two vendors can advertise nearly identical headline rates while one bill lands at double the other, purely because of what the number includes.
Watch these four in particular:
- Speech-to-text. Priced per minute of audio processed, sometimes with premiums for higher accuracy models or specialized vocabularies.
- The language model. Usually priced per token. A chatty agent, a long system prompt, or heavy retrieval context all raise token consumption per call — invisibly.
- Text-to-speech. Priced per character or per minute of generated audio. Premium, more natural voices cost meaningfully more than basic ones.
- Telephony. Per-minute carrier charges, plus per-number rental, and sometimes separate inbound and outbound rates.
None of these is hidden in a sinister sense. They are simply below the fold. The advertised rate answers "what does the orchestration cost," when the question you need answered is "what does a completed call cost."
Integration and engineering cost
The rate card assumes the agent already works with your systems. It never does on day one.
A voice agent that cannot look up an order, check an appointment, or authenticate a caller is a very expensive answering machine. Making it useful means integration work: connecting your CRM, your scheduling system, your knowledge base, your telephony routing. That work is engineering time, and engineering time is money the vendor's rate never mentions.
This cost is a classic transaction cost — the effort of making the deal actually function, over and above the price of the thing itself. It shows up as weeks of developer effort, ongoing maintenance when your backend APIs change, and the internal coordination to test and deploy safely. For a serious deployment it can dwarf the first year of usage fees. Our guide on why voice agents fail in production covers how thin integration quietly sinks otherwise promising pilots.
Build this into your model as a real line, not a footnote. A rate that looks great per minute can still lose to a slightly pricier vendor whose integrations are turnkey.
The cost of failed and unresolved calls
Every call you pay for is not a call that worked. This is the line item buyers understand least, and it is often the largest.
Consider what happens when an agent takes a call, spends ninety seconds fumbling, and fails to resolve the issue. You paid for those ninety seconds. The caller's problem still exists. So they call back — and you pay again. Or they escalate to a human, and you pay for the agent minutes and the human minutes. A single unresolved issue can generate two, three, or four billed interactions before it closes.
This is why the per-minute rate is a misleading unit. The unit that matters is a resolved contact, which is exactly the argument in our cost-per-resolution breakdown. If half your calls fail, your true cost per resolution is double the arithmetic — before you count the repeat calls the failures spawned.
Failed calls also carry a downstream cost that never touches the invoice. A caller who could not get help is a caller more likely to churn. That lost revenue is real, and it belongs in any honest cost accounting of the deployment.
Escalation and human-handoff cost
Handoff to a human is the safety net, and it is also a cost multiplier. When the agent gives up, the call routes to a person — and now you are paying for both.
The economics only work if the agent contains a high share of calls on its own. A deployment that escalates most calls has essentially added an expensive front-end to your existing contact center rather than replacing any of it. Worse, poorly designed handoffs frustrate callers, who must repeat themselves to the human, extending the human's handle time and cost.
There is a subtle trap here too. Vendors sometimes report high containment while quietly counting deflection — calls the agent ended without truly resolving — as contained. That inflates the apparent savings. The distinction matters enough that we wrote a full explainer on containment versus deflection. A call the agent hung up on is not a call it handled.
Overage and volume-tier surprises
Pricing tiers are where the model you built and the bill you receive diverge most sharply.
Volume discounts sound like pure upside. In practice they come with commitments, minimums, and overage rates that reset the math. A few patterns to watch:
- Minimum commitments. You agree to a monthly floor. If your volume dips — a slow season, a product change — you pay for minutes you never used.
- Overage penalties. Exceed the tier and the marginal rate can jump well above your blended average, so a good month costs disproportionately more.
- Feature gating. The advertised rate may exclude analytics, recordings, or premium voices that live in a higher tier you end up needing.
- Annual true-ups. Some contracts reconcile usage annually, producing a surprise charge long after the budgeting window closed.
Tiered pricing rewards predictable, steady volume. Real contact volume is spiky. Model your best and worst months, not just the average, or the overage line will find you.
The hidden cost of low quality
The most expensive line item is the one with no line at all: poor quality.
A voice agent that mishears names, loses context mid-conversation, or answers confidently but wrongly does not just fail the call it is on. It erodes trust in every future call. Customers who have one bad experience avoid the channel, call during peak hours, demand a human immediately, or leave for a competitor. None of that shows up on the vendor invoice, and all of it hits your P&L.
Latency is part of this. Long silences and awkward pauses make callers hang up or talk over the agent, spiking failure rates. The ITU-T G.114 recommendation on acceptable one-way latency for voice is a useful reference point for how sensitive people are to delay. An agent that feels sluggish is an agent that loses calls.
Quality is the multiplier that sits behind every other cost in this post. High quality means more resolutions, fewer repeats, fewer escalations, and fewer lost customers. Low quality inflates every one of them at once. This is why measuring quality before you sign — not after the bill arrives — is the single highest-leverage thing a buyer can do.
Advertised versus all-in: a worked comparison
The table below shows how a clean advertised rate expands once every real line item is counted. The figures are illustrative ballparks, not vendor quotes — the point is the shape of the gap, not the exact numbers.
| Cost line | On the rate card? | Illustrative impact on per-minute cost |
|---|---|---|
| Orchestration (the advertised rate) | Yes | ~$0.05 |
| Speech-to-text | Sometimes | +$0.01–$0.03 |
| Language model tokens | Rarely | +$0.02–$0.06 |
| Text-to-speech | Sometimes | +$0.01–$0.03 |
| Telephony | Rarely | +$0.01–$0.02 |
| Integration and maintenance | No | Amortized; often large upfront |
| Failed and repeat calls | No | Multiplies cost per resolution |
| Human escalation | No | Adds agent minutes at full loaded cost |
| Overage and tier penalties | Buried in contract | Spikes in peak months |
| Lost customers from poor quality | No | Off-invoice, potentially the largest |
| All-in effective rate | — | Often $0.20+ per minute |
An advertised rate near five cents can land above twenty cents all-in once the pass-through components alone are stacked — and that is before failed calls and escalations bend the cost-per-resolution number upward.
How to uncover the true all-in cost
Follow these steps to replace the advertised rate with a number you can actually budget against.
1. List every metered component. Ask the vendor, in writing, whether speech-to-text, the language model, text-to-speech, and telephony are bundled or passed through. Get per-unit rates for each.
2. Estimate consumption per call. Multiply typical call length and token usage by your real volume. Model an average call and a long, messy one — the messy ones drive the bill.
3. Quantify integration up front. Scope the engineering days to connect your systems and maintain them. Amortize that across expected call volume as a real per-minute add.
4. Measure resolution rate, not call count. Run representative calls and count how many actually close the issue. Divide total cost by resolutions, not by minutes. Our vendor evaluation guide walks through this.
5. Price the escalations. Estimate the share of calls handed to humans and add the loaded human cost for those minutes on top of the agent minutes.
6. Stress-test the tiers. Model your highest and lowest volume months against the contract's minimums and overage rates, not just the average.
7. Put a number on quality risk. Estimate repeat-call rate and likely churn from poor experiences. Even a rough figure keeps the largest hidden cost visible in the decision.
Work through all seven and the all-in cost of a voice agent stops being a mystery. The procurement checklist turns these questions into contract language before you sign.
Frequently asked questions
Why is my voice agent bill higher than the advertised per-minute rate?
Because the advertised rate usually covers only the orchestration layer. Speech-to-text, the language model, text-to-speech, and telephony are often billed separately or passed through. Add integration, escalations, and overage, and the effective rate commonly lands several times higher than the headline number you compared across vendors.
What are pass-through component fees in voice agent pricing?
Pass-through fees are the costs of the underlying services a vendor charges you directly rather than absorbing. The four main ones are speech-to-text, language model tokens, text-to-speech, and telephony. Some vendors bundle them into one rate; others quote a thin orchestration fee and forward each component cost to your invoice.
How much does integration add to voice agent costs?
Integration is engineering time to connect your CRM, scheduling, knowledge base, and telephony, plus ongoing maintenance. It never appears on a rate card. For a serious deployment it can exceed the first year of usage fees, so treat it as a real line item amortized across your expected call volume.
Do I pay for failed voice agent calls?
Yes. You are billed for the minutes of a call whether or not it resolves the issue. A failed call often triggers a repeat call or a human escalation, so a single unresolved issue can generate several billed interactions. This is why cost per resolution matters more than cost per minute.
What is the difference between containment and deflection in pricing?
Containment means the agent genuinely resolved the call without a human. Deflection means the agent ended the call without necessarily solving anything. Some vendors count both as contained, inflating apparent savings. A deflected caller who calls back or churns costs you more, not less, than an honest escalation would have.
How do overage and volume tiers create surprise costs?
Volume tiers add minimum commitments, overage penalties, and feature gating. You pay a floor even in slow months, and exceeding a tier can spike the marginal rate above your blended average. Some contracts also reconcile usage annually, producing a charge long after the budget window closed. Model peak and trough months, not just the average.
What is the hidden cost of low voice agent quality?
Low quality drives repeat calls, escalations, and customer churn — none of which appear on the vendor invoice. A caller who has a bad experience avoids the channel or leaves for a competitor. Because quality multiplies every other cost, measuring it before signing is the highest-leverage move a buyer can make.
How do I compare voice agent vendors on true cost?
Do not compare advertised rates. Compare all-in cost per resolution: metered components, integration, escalations, and quality risk included. Run the same representative calls against each vendor, measure real resolution rates, and normalize everything to a resolved contact. The cheapest headline rate frequently loses on the number that actually determines your bill.
